Transaction c43c1e6569fe7fbd675650dd6a4e64e10e061e38f862d8e6762db5f18b8e404b
2 Input
1 Outputs
- c43c1e6569fe7fbd675650dd6a4e64e10e061e38f862d8e6762db5f18b8e404b:0
value 17161633
address 1HzfcZdeUVPgtn9eE2nMjQBjxNNKx1rjpy